You start your car from rest and accelerate at a constant rate along a straight path. Your speed is \(20 \mathrm{~m} / \mathrm{s}\) after \(1.0 \mathrm{~min}\).

(a) What is your acceleration?

(b) How far do you travel during that \(1.0 \mathrm{~min}\) ?
